What You’ll Be Doing:
- Architecting and optimizing high-performance simulation kernels for the Synopsys VCS RTL simulator using advanced C++ techniques.
- Exploring and implementing GPU acceleration strategies with CUDA to significantly reduce simulation runtimes for customers.
- Leveraging deep knowledge of Verilog/SystemVerilog LRM to ensure accurate and reliable simulation across diverse design environments.
- Integrating AI-powered tools (such as Cursor, GitHub Copilot, and generative AI assistants) to automate code generation and debugging processes.
- Mentoring and guiding junior engineers, fostering skills development and technical growth within the team.
- Collaborating with distributed R&D teams to maintain Synopsys’ leadership and drive innovation in the EDA industry.
- Analyzing performance bottlenecks and proposing architectural improvements to enable "shift-left" verification strategies for global semiconductor customers.

What You’ll Need:
- 8-10 years of relevant experience
- Expert-level proficiency in C++ with proven experience in performance-critical software development.
- Deep understanding of Verilog/SystemVerilog Language Reference Manuals (LRM) and simulation methodologies.
- Hands-on experience with GPU programming, especially using CUDA for parallel acceleration.
- Familiarity with AI-powered development tools such as Cursor, GitHub Copilot, and generative AI assistants.
- Strong architectural design skills and ability to analyze and optimize complex software systems.
- Experience in mentoring and guiding junior engineers within an R&D environment.
